Job Description Summary

The Recruitment Web Developer reports to the Director of EMSS Operations and works in close partnership with the University Communications and Marketing (UCM) team to build modern, user-focused digital experiences for prospective students at Miami University. This role focuses on building and maintaining custom portals, landing pages, and interactive web experiences that support recruitment and communication efforts.
Working closely with marketing, enrollment, and technical teams, you will help translate recruitment strategies into responsive, accessible, and scalable web experiences powered by our recruitment system, Slate. The role emphasizes front-end development using H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, along with building personalized content and integrating systems that support communication and engagement with prospective students.
This is an opportunity to work on high-visibility digital experiences seen by hundreds of thousands of prospective students each year while contributing to the continued evolution of recruitment technology and communications at Miami University.

Job Description

Job Description

  • Develop and maintain modern, user-centered web experiences for prospective students, powered by our recruitment systems.

  • Develop and maintain custom portals to support recruitment, admission, and marketing initiatives.

  • Build dynamic, personalized web content using modern front-end techniques and CRM-driven data.

  • Partner with marketing and admission teams to translate campaign strategy into scalable technical solutions.

  • Lead HTML, CSS, and JavaScript development for emails, landing pages, and interactive portal experiences, with a strong focus on accessibility and performance.

  • Implement segmentation and personalization strategies defined by marketing and operations teams.

  • Collaborate with technologists and stakeholders to integrate institutional systems with marketing automation, analytics, and other platforms.

  • Stay current with evolving web technologies and digital engagement trends to drive innovation in recruitment communications.

  • Contribute to improving front-end experiences and technical capabilities within our recruitment systems.

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ree or Associate's Degree and two years of experience, or five years of experience.

  • Experience designing, developing, and deploying customer-facing web solutions.

  • Experience with a CRM or marketing technology platform (e.g., Technolutions Slate, Salesforce, or similar systems).

Preferred Qualifications
  • 3 years of experience with APIs, Liquid, or advanced web development features for data integration and dynamic content.

  • 3 years of experience integrating CRM platforms with marketing automation, analytics, or reporting tools.

  • Experience supporting higher education marketing, enrollment, or customer-facing digital communications at scale.

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• Proficiency in H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, with experience building interactive, accessible, and high-performance digital spaces.

  • Strong eye for layout, usability, and interaction design.

  • Ability to translate brand and marketing goals into polished digital experiences.

  • Familiarity with marketing platforms, data-driven content, or personalization is a plus.

  • Familiarity with customer segmentation, email marketing, and campaign execution workflows.

  • Ability to collaborate effectively with creative, marketing, enrollment, and technical stakeholders to translate strategy into working systems.

  • Comfort owning systems, making technical decisions, and improving platforms over time (not just keeping the lights on).
